Police Retrieve Handcuffs After Mob Seizes Suspect

Paba, Rajshahi – Police in Paba Upazila successfully recovered handcuffs from a detained suspect following a dramatic incident in which he was briefly seized by a mob. Local intermediaries reportedly helped return the restraints, though authorities have declined to officially confirm the method, adding to speculation surrounding the unusual recovery.

The incident occurred during a robbery investigation involving a young man named Rasel. On Sunday, 22 March, a team of eight officers from Paba Police Station arrested him at Pillapara Mor near Sahida Haque Filling Station. Witnesses said that Rasel’s mother, several relatives, and local residents gathered at the scene and forcibly took him from police custody, creating a tense standoff.

Residents reported that the mob removed Rasel while he was still wearing handcuffs. Police later sought to retrieve the restraints and, according to locals, enlisted the help of intermediaries. Approximately two hours later, the handcuffs were recovered intact. Locals claimed that a few individuals were given a key and used it to unlock the cuffs from Rasel before returning them to the authorities.

Rasel’s arrest was connected to an earlier case. On 15 March, Afshar Ali filed a complaint accusing him of assault, and Rasel had subsequently been taken into custody in relation to that investigation.

When asked about the handcuff recovery, Paba Police Officer-in-Charge Jahangir Alam said he could not comment at the time, citing ongoing patrol duties. Rajshahi Metropolitan Police spokesperson Additional Deputy Commissioner Gaziur Rahman confirmed that the handcuffs had been retrieved but said that claims of using a key to recover them were unverified. He also stated that the police had filed a case regarding the robbery and that three individuals had been arrested and sent to jail, though it remained unclear whether Rasel was among them.

The incident has drawn attention to the challenges law enforcement faces when mobs intervene during arrests. Observers noted that, while the handcuffs were eventually returned, the episode highlighted the difficulties officers face in controlling high-tension situations and the potential risks posed to both police personnel and suspects.
